Create database schema document from existing MySQL database. == MySQL: Table document (Schema) == Sample result of mysql query using {{kbd | key=EXPLAIN}} syntax<ref>[https://dev.mysql.com/doc/refman/8.0/en/explain.html MySQL :: MySQL 8.0 Reference Manual :: 13.8.2 EXPLAIN Syntax]</ref>: {{kbd | key =<nowiki>EXPLAIN <table></nowiki>}} <pre> Field | Type | Null | Key | Default | Extra </pre> Sample result of mysql query using {{kbd | key=SHOW}} syntax<ref>[https://dev.mysql.com/doc/refman/8.0/en/show-columns.html MySQL :: MySQL 8.0 Reference Manual :: 13.7.6.5 SHOW COLUMNS Syntax]</ref>: {{kbd | key =<nowiki>SHOW FULL COLUMNS FROM <table></nowiki>}} <pre> Field | Type | Collation | Null | Key | Default | Extra | Privileges | Comment </pre> Steps of create database schema document for MySQL # Using web-based database management software such as: [https://www.phpmyadmin.net/ phpMyAdmin] or [https://www.adminer.org/ Adminer] # SQL query: {{kbd | key =<nowiki>EXPLAIN <table></nowiki>}} or {{kbd | key =<nowiki>SHOW FULL COLUMNS FROM <table></nowiki>}} # (for phpMyAdmin) Click "Print view (with full texts)" # Copy the table to other word processors == MySQL: DDL document == [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Data_definition_language Data definition language] (DDL): Sample result of mysql query: {{kbd | key =<nowiki>SHOW CREATE TABLE <table></nowiki>}} <pre> CREATE TABLE `table` ( `id` varchar(30) NOT NULL, `note` varchar(30) DEFAULT NULL, `status` int(1) NOT NULL DEFAULT '1', `update_time` datetime DEFAULT CURRENT_TIMESTAMP ) ENGINE=InnoDB DEFAULT CHARSET=utf8 </pre> Tools: SQL syntax beautifier * [http://www.dpriver.com/pp/sqlformat.htm Instant SQL Formatter] == PostgreSQL: Table document (Schema) == <pre> SELECT -- *, a.column_name AS "Field", a.data_type AS "Type", a.character_maximum_length AS "Length", a.is_nullable AS "Null", b.constraint_type AS "Key", a.column_default AS "Default" FROM information_schema.columns AS a LEFT JOIN ( SELECT c.column_name, c.data_type, constraint_type FROM information_schema.table_constraints tc JOIN information_schema.constraint_column_usage AS ccu USING (constraint_schema, constraint_name) JOIN information_schema.columns AS c ON c.table_schema = tc.constraint_schema AND tc.table_name = c.table_name AND ccu.column_name = c.column_name WHERE tc.table_name = '<MY_TABLE>' ) AS b ON b.column_name = a.column_name WHERE a.table_name = '<MY_TABLE>'; </pre> == PostgreSQL: DDL document == [https://www.postgresql.org/docs/current/app-pgdump.html PostgreSQL: Documentation: 14: pg_dump]<ref>[https://serverfault.com/questions/231952/is-there-an-equivalent-of-mysqls-show-create-table-in-postgres postgresql - Is there an equivalent of MySQL's SHOW CREATE TABLE in Postgres? - Server Fault]</ref> <pre> pg_dump -st <MY_TABLE> <MY_DATABASE> --schema-only > schema.sql </pre> {{exclaim}} The parameter {{kbd | key=<nowiki><MY_TABLE></nowiki>}} is before than another parameter {{kbd | key=<nowiki><MY_DATABASE></nowiki>}} == References == <references /> Related pages: * [[Data type]] [[Category:MySQL]] [[Category:Database]] [[Category:PostgreSQL]] [[Category:Data Science]]
